MAc 启动mongodb
时间: 2024-06-27 17:00:57 浏览: 316
在Mac上启动MongoDB,首先你需要确保已经安装了MongoDB。如果你还没有安装,可以通过Homebrew(一个包管理器)来安装:
1. 打开终端(Terminal)。
2. 安装Homebrew,如果尚未安装,输入以下命令: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/main/install.sh)"
```
3. 安装MongoDB,使用Homebrew:
```
brew install mongodb
```
安装完成后,你可以通过以下命令启动MongoDB服务:
```bash
mongod
```
这将启动默认的本地数据库服务。如果你想在后台运行并作为服务启动,可以使用`mongod --background`,或者设置开机启动(需要管理员权限):
```bash
sudo launchctl load ~/Library/LaunchAgents/homebrew.mxcl.mongodb.plist
```
确保在`~/Library/LaunchAgents`目录下存在homebrew.mxcl.mongodb.plist文件。
相关问题
启动mongodb命令
MongoDB是一个流行的分布式文档型数据库系统,通常通过终端命令行来启动。以下是Windows、Linux/Mac OS通用的启动步骤:
1. **Windows**:
- 打开命令提示符(`cmd`),然后定位到MongoDB安装目录下的bin文件夹。
- 输入以下命令并按回车:
```
mongod.exe
```
- 如果你是首次运行,可能会看到一些日志信息,并询问是否需要创建默认用户。输入`y`表示同意。
2. **Linux/Mac OS (使用终端)**:
- 打开终端,然后定位到MongoDB的安装路径,通常是`/usr/local/bin` 或 `~/mongodb/bin`。
- 输入以下命令:
```
sudo mongod
```
- 使用`sudo`是因为mongod需要管理员权限。如果尚未添加到系统用户的环境变量中,可以直接在该目录下运行。
确保在启动前,MongoDB服务已经安装并且配置正确。你可以通过访问`http://localhost:27017` 来检查是否成功启动,并查看数据库的状态。
如何启动mongodb
MongoDB是一款流行的文档型数据库,通常通过命令行工具或配置服务的方式启动。以下是Windows、Linux/Mac和命令行启动的基本步骤:
**Windows:**
1. 打开命令提示符(管理员权限)。
2. 导航到MongoDB安装目录,例如 `C:\Program Files\MongoDB\Server\4.4\bin`。
3. 输入命令 `mongod.exe` 或者 `start-mongod.sh` (如果使用的是社区版安装)。
**Linux/Mac (终端):**
1. 打开终端。
2. 切换到MongoDB的bin目录,比如 `/usr/local/bin` 或者 `~/mongo/db/bin`。
3. 运行 `mongod` 命令。如果你启用了系统服务,可以使用 `sudo service mongod start` 或者 `systemctl start mongodb`.
**命令行启动:**
- 对于Docker容器化部署,可以在命令行运行 `docker run -d --name my-mongodb -p 27017:27017 mongo`。
- 如果是云环境,如AWS的Elasticsearch Service或Azure Cosmos DB,只需登录相应的控制台并管理实例即可。
启动成功后,你应该能看到类似 "db started" 的消息,并且可以通过 `mongo` 命令连接到默认的数据库。
阅读全文